How did the Efficiency 30% come about? Hands-on dismantling from a business
Don't believe the adverts look at the results! A true case of remodelling in a local electronics factory:
- sore pointMobile phone camera mounter is always running out of order, jamming 3 times per hour, with a capacity of less than 8,000 pieces in 24 hours;
- Upgrade programme::
- Remove the gear belt and put on the linear motor module;
- Add scale real-time correction (hairline error immediately alarm);
- Linked ERP system automatically schedules tasks;
- in the end::
- Zeroing the number of card stops, with 24-hour capacity soaring to 11,000 pieces;
- Saved 2 inspectors.The annual manpower cost is cut by $400,000;
- The meter is reversed.--Monthly power consumption was pressed down from 30,000 kWh to 18,000 kWh.
Here comes the key.The 30% efficiency gains are not to be blown away!
- 15% from speed lapping (10m/s vs 2m/s);
- The 10% came from a zero-failure shutdown (cog belt said to fall apart);
- 5% from Intelligent Dispatch (the system automatically bypasses traffic jams).
